After decades of evil deeds done in darkness, this last month has been a great reckoning, with prominent individuals being exposed by their accusers. Harvey Weinstein, Kevin Spacey, Louis C.K., Matt Lauer, Charlie Rose, Garrison Keillor, Senator Al Franken, Congressman John Conyers, Russell Simmons and former President Bill Clinton are in this rogues' gallery. Allegations from 40 years ago have also been brought against Alabama Senate candidate Roy Moore, but unlike those above, he categorically denies their validity.

Now we're hearing of the uncovering of "hush money" payments by members of Congress to assault victims from our taxes! Christian Congresswoman Marsha Blackburn cosponsored a bill after discovering the startling claim that over $17 million of taxpayer money has gone to 286 secret settlements.

Heightened Harassment Sensitivity 

An NBC/Wall Street Journal poll of American adults conducted recently revealed that 48 percent of employed women now admit they've personally experienced sexual harassment in the workplace. Nearly 71 percent of women, and 62 percent of men disagreed with the idea that harassment reports are overblown.

Whether egregious sexual imposition, indecent exposure, rape or simply "low-level lechery" towards women (sexual innuendo, raunchy humor and unwelcome advances), multitudes of women are becoming a part of the #MeTooMovement and speaking up.

Likewise, millions of God-fearing Americans are deeply disturbed to learn about so many sexual predators loose today.

Northwestern University professor Laura Kipnis, who authored the book, Unwanted Advances: Sexual Paranoia Comes to Campus, says, "What's shocking about a lot of these revelations is the extent to which men in power have felt they have free access to the bodies of women who work for them, or aspire to."

Twenty-two years ago, the late Pope John Paul II prophetically addressed the degrading of women in the area of sexuality. "The time has come to condemn ... the types of sexual violence which frequently have women for their object, and to pass laws which effectively defend them from such violence." He instructed us to learn from "the attitude of Jesus" who transcended "the established norms of His own culture and treated women with openness, respect, acceptance and tenderness."
